    If you can choose...

    If someone offered you one of the following, which one will you choose ?

    - $120 cash (no restrictions, can be cashed out)
    - $250 bonus, 15x WR (no max cashout), slots only

    Both are ND-bonusses (loyalty points).

    Suggestions ?
